I paid ?155 for this at a popular local etailer, I went to pick it up to save a further ?5 or so for shipping and I had to have it "now" heh.Specss (from ocuk, a syou can see, ocuk poo'd badly on the spec...)

- 5ms Response Time (LIES! it's actually 8ms)

- 0.294mm of Pixels Pitch

- 800:1 Contrast Ratio

- 300 CDm? Brightness

- 170?/ 155? (h./v.) Viewing Angles

- frequency range 31 to 80kHz horizontal an75Hz75Hz vertically

- Automatic Picture Synchronisation

- 1440 x 900 with 60Hz recommended resolution (LIES! 75Hz at max res is this screens optimum set by Hyundai)

- 16.2 million colors display (LIES! 16.7 million colors)

- 2 x Analogue Input

- 1 x DVI input

- integrated loudspeaker (2ch x 2 Watts RMS)

It's very user friendly, the controls and OSD are logical and easy to manage, I had no issues here at all. Even getting the cables in was quite easy. Hyundai bundled both EU and UK plug leads with it, shame there was no DVI cable though, only 1x Performanceance

Nothing but praise here, I've played some CS:S and will reinstall FEAR shortly, I have watched some HD trailers and watched a bit of Fifth Element in HD - they look awesome, no ghosting anywhere at all!

One thing that stuck out on this screen was that the colour tone by default is very white, I like this since I work with Photos alot so accurate whites are important. I also found the blacks to be very good too - The contrast was nice enough and even when set high it didn't cause my eyes to fatugueImage qualitylityCompared to...o...

Samsung 6ms 940BW Widescreen

- Clarity is much better, though this is probably down to the fact I am using DVI and the Samsung is not, I suspect the samsung will be just as good probably when DVI is used.

- The Samsung has more visible backlight bleeding, the N91w has SOME bleeding but it's not easily noticable on my sample unless you look for it, this to me is acceptable.

- Samsung has more customisation for stand and menu options

- The Hyundai looks much much nicer

- The Samsung suffers from bezel highlighting when watching movies in the dark as it's all silver..

- Photos look nicer on the Hyundai thanks to the 800:1 conConclusionsions

There are some small niggles though which are noted below, as always they are user preferences and different people will have different views on such things...

- The stand is slick but only tilt movement available. Why no swivel or height? the stand itself could easily accomodate this from design alone.

- By default the brightness is all the way up and contrast set to 50, what's the deal here ?

- Only a VGA cable supplied, for a screen with 3 inputs they should have bundled 3 cables, this screen works very nice with DVI so why not bundle a DVI cable instead if only /one/ is to be bundled?

- The "manual" is like a small booklet, only teh first page is in english...lol.

    • Ford execs say they made a mistake when they replaced human engineers with AI by David Uzondu Ford recently announced that over the last three years, it's had to rehire about 350 "gray beard" engineers to mentor younger staff and reprogram diagnostic systems and AI tools that were failing to meet up to quality expectations. The company's VP of vehicle hardware engineering, Charles **** said that leaders overlooked the deep experience of veterans who survived many product cycles. **** admitted that simply replacing them with AI was a huge mistake, and that while AI is "a fantastic tool," it remains "only as good as the information you use to train it." The rehired engineers now run mandatory meetings to troubleshoot vehicles and reprogram automated engineering software and AI tools to prevent glitches before production. These technical specialists hunt for failure points before parts ever reach the plant floor, helping prevent the massive recalls and defects that previously cost the company billions as it aims to cut one billion dollars in expenses this year. In last year's JD Power Quality Survey, an annual study that measures the quality of a car during the first three months of ownership, Ford finished 10th among mainstream brands and scored below the industry average. But this year, JD Power ranked the automaker as the top mainstream brand, placing it above the likes of Toyota Motor Corp. and Honda Motor Co. Ford attributed this massive improvement directly to the expertise of these returned engineers. Ford's realization that AI cannot magically design and test quality vehicles without senior human oversight is just the tip of the iceberg. When Careerminds looked at companies that conducted AI-driven layoffs, researchers found out that 35.6% of those companies had to rehire more than half of the employees they previously fired. Another 32.7% had to rehire between 25% and 50% of them. In 2024, Sebastian Siemiatkowski, CEO of Klarna, proudly announced that its new chatbot was doing the work of 700 full-time customer service agents. As a result, the fintech company froze hiring and cut hundreds of positions. But by mid 2025, and into 2026, Klarna was scrambling to recruit human agents again because customer satisfaction had plummeted. It turns out, while AI is very good at answering basic questions like how to check an account balance, when faced with complex customer issues that require nuance, the thing usually resorts to the unhelpful, robotic corporate jargon we all know and love.
